Bubbles in safe house as Hurricane Ian hits Florida

With the terrible news coming from Florida, US and the devastating Hurricane Ian, we have the confirmation that Bubbles and all his 69 friends are safe!

The staff of the Center of Great Apes have evacuated the animals (included Bubbles) to a shelter/safe house waiting for the Hurricane to pass.

The Wauchula facility is prepared for hurricanes and has secure areas for the apes and orangutans to stay in during dangerous storms. “The maintenance team has boarded up all the offices and homes, sandbags have been placed in the areas prone to flooding, supplies have been purchased, and our caregivers have prepared the apes’ night houses, diets, and special enrichment during the storm,” the center reassured on its website. “They are heated in the winter and strong enough to withstand Florida hurricanes.”

The rooms also include spacious hammocks, where several apes and orangutans awaited Ian’s arrival. Besides Bubbles, the institute is also home to over 70 other great apes, many of which were rescued from careers in the entertainment business or private zoos. The 100 acres that make up the facility are open for residents to use as they like.
